Beautiful Coastal Coach Holidays in Ireland

A great selection of coastal holiday destinations in Ireland by coach

Discover our coach holidays to some of the most popular coastal destinations in Ireland. 

Whether you’re looking to relax and unwind, learn more about the country’s fascinating history, or you’d like to visit some interesting attractions, we’ve got it covered.

Join us on a holiday to Donegal, a beautiful county in the northwest of Ireland, known for its natural beauty and rich history. With a strong cultural heritage, there’s lots to explore, including ancient ruins, magnificent castles and the attractive market town of Donegal itself. Enjoy a break in the picturesque town of Letterkenny, in the heart of County Donegal. Whether you’re wanting to relax on the beach, uncover the rich culture of the area or take wonderful walks around the pretty town, Letterkenny has it all.

Journey along the attractive Antrim Coast and visit Giant’s Causeway, one of the most impressive natural wonders in the world. Admire the rugged formation of this unique attraction, designated a UNESCO World Heritage Site. Explore another natural wonder, the Cliffs of Moher, which tower over the beautiful west coast of Ireland. Standing at over 700 feet tall, you can experience breathtaking views over the Atlantic Ocean.

The Giants Causeway
Prepare to be awestruck by the natural wonder that is the Giants Causeway. This UNESCO World Heritage Site boasts 40,000 interlocking hexagonal basalt columns, formed by volcanic activity millions of years ago. Walk in the footsteps of giants as you explore this otherworldly landscape and listen to the legends that surround it.

Tralee
Nestled on the captivating west coast of Ireland, Tralee blends rich history, stunning landscapes, and famous Irish hospitality. With its picturesque countryside, rugged coastline, and a vibrant town centre, Tralee offers something for everyone. Explore Tralee's historical treasures, from the Blennerville Windmill to the medieval Tralee Castle and imerse yourself in Irish culture.

The Ring of Kerry
Journey through the breathtaking scenery around the famous Ring of Kerry, with rolling hills, soaring mountains, rugged Atlantic coastline and quaint traditional villages. Discover the mystical & unspoilt region of Ireland that has attracted visitors for hundreds of years – the Ring of Kerry.

Killarney
Located in Kerry in the South West of Ireland, Killarney is one of the most delightful towns you will visit! Lying at the foot of Ireland’s highest mountain range, MacGillycuddy’s Reeks, Killarney is a picturesque town with a choice of lively bars and restaurants.
